Depending on your exact device (Smartphone or Tablet), and which generation you have, the menu theme and options might look slightly different on your screen. However, the steps should be similar across all Android devices and generations.
- Open Settings.
- Select Wi-Fi.
- Select the Bebop2_xxxxx Wi-Fi network from the list.
By default, you don't need to enter a Wi-Fi password. You only need to enter one if you set it yourself.
- Launch the FreeFlight Pro app on your mobile device.
- The app will connect automatically to the Parrot drone and show the Wi-Fi symbol towards the top right.
